Abstract

The invention relates to the technical field of electronic information and provides a navigation method to solve the technical problems of a single navigation task and failure in flexibility and variability in the prior art. The navigation method is applied to navigation equipment and comprises the steps of receiving names of a plurality of to-be-reached destinations input by a user, locating positions where the destinations are located with a base station, planning a passing sequence of the destinations, and planning routes between the destinations according to the planned passing sequence of the destinations to further achieve technical effects of achieving flexible navigation and providing a more optimized navigation route for the user.

Embodiment
The present invention, by providing a kind of air navigation aid, solves in prior art that to there is navigation task single, technical matters that can not be flexible and changeable, and then achieves and can navigate flexibly, for user provides the technique effect of the navigation circuit more optimized.
In order to solve, to there is navigation task in above-mentioned prior art single, and technical matters that can not be flexible and changeable, is described in detail technique scheme below in conjunction with Figure of description and concrete embodiment.
A kind of air navigation aid that the embodiment of the present invention provides, is applied in navigational system, as shown in Figure 1, comprise: S101, multiple destinations title that the needs receiving user's input arrive, such as, user needs the thing done one day today, comprise supermarket to do shopping, send clothes to laundry, visit certain friend, therefore, three places can be set, supermarket, the family of laundry and friend.Then, these three place names are all inputted in navigator, then, perform S102, utilize the position of base station to title place, multiple destination to position, cook up the order of multiple destination priority process.Particularly, the information of location can be sent to base station by this navigator, and receive the locating information that base station feedback returns, like this, just specifically can obtain the positional information of these three destinations that above-mentioned user provides, according to the current residing position of user, cook up further user need successively through three destinations, such as, supermarket is the nearest place of current distance users, so first stop first arrives supermarket, then, after user arrives supermarket, the destination nearest apart from supermarket is the family of friend, second station just arrives the family of friend, finally, go to laundry again.Now, the sequencing of the destination cooked up by this navigator is followed successively by supermarket, the family of friend, laundry.
Certainly, can also plan according to the sequencing of time to multiple destination of user's setting, such as user visiting friend is set between 11:00 ~ 12:00 in the morning, the time of two destinations of remaining arrival can be any.Like this, can using friend family as first stop, laundry is as second station, and supermarket is as the 3rd station.Just no longer be described in detail in a particular embodiment.
After the order having cooked up multiple destinations priority process, can be shown by the order of the display of this navigator by these destinations, can also be broadcasted by the order of the loudspeaker of navigator by these destinations.
Then, perform S103, according to the order of the multiple destinations cooked up successively process, between each destination, carry out planning circuit.In a particular embodiment, after the destination determining successively process, user can arrange some conditions, such as the time is short, and so this navigator just can carry out planning circuit according to the condition of shortest time time of carrying out between each destination; Can also be that circuit is the most unimpeded, the congestion so in this navigator circuit that can experience in the past according to user, judges which bar circuit is the most unimpeded, thus plans between two destinations.Thus the demand of user can be met, reach the object of navigation flexibly.
